Position Overview
As an LPN/RN, you will provide high-quality nursing care that adheres to federal, state, and local standards, ensuring elders’ safety and well-being. You will assess, monitor, and deliver treatments while guiding and supervising nursing assistants.
Responsibilities
- Administer medications and treatments as prescribed by physicians.
- Conduct medical assessments, monitoring vital signs, and responding to changes in condition.
- Supervise and guide nursing assistants, ensuring compliance with standards of care.
- Assist with elder admissions, discharges, and transfers.
- Document care in electronic health records (Point Click Care) and maintain accurate clinical records.
- Communicate with families, physicians, and interdisciplinary teams to ensure elders’ needs are met.
- Participate in the development and implementation of care plans that address elders’ physical, emotional, and spiritual needs.
- Educate elders and their families about medications, treatment plans, and wellness practices.
Qualifications
- Graduate of an accredited school of nursing.
- LPN: Valid Ohio Licensed Practical Nurse license.
- RN: Valid Ohio Registered Nurse license.
- Current CPR certification (American Heart Association preferred).
- Strong communication and critical thinking skills.
- Willingness to care for older adults and commitment to the organization’s mission.
- Ability to read, write, speak, and understand the English language.
Preferred Qualifications
- Experience in long-term care or geriatric nursing.
- Proficiency in Point Click Care and Microsoft Office software.
Physical and Environmental Requirements
- Frequent standing, walking, bending, and stretching for up to 75% of an 8 or 12-hour shift.
- Ability to lift, push, and pull up to 100 lbs occasionally, 50 lbs frequently, and 20 lbs constantly.
- Exposure to bodily fluids, infectious diseases, and sharp instruments.
- Ability to push and pull medication carts weighing up to 300 lbs.
- Work in a variety of environments (clean, cluttered, organized, unsanitary, etc.).
Supervisory Responsibilities
Supervise and guide CNA's, including scheduling, training, and monitoring performance.
